Output 0402b94bda75c58cb1ec6897e48df0be60332c3cb133cb78edf7c73a2a0dd75a:1

value
93804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d8970924d9853bb9ca84431d0ee780dd3fc5f5 OP_EQUAL
address
33VxE8AigPAJTePQwhZPzLXTKCSX1dFqAg
transaction
0402b94bda75c58cb1ec6897e48df0be60332c3cb133cb78edf7c73a2a0dd75a
confirmations
77635
spent
true